  • Patent number: 9704454
    Abstract: A display control device including: an input control unit which receives a scrolling start indication and a scrolling stop indication from a user; a scrolling control unit which, if the scrolling stop indication is received, decelerates a scroll rate by a predetermined function and pre-calculates a location of a displayed area when the scrolling of the displayed area stops; and a focus control unit which superimposes a focus on an object closest to a predetermined position within the displayed area at any time from when the location of the displayed area when the scrolling stops is determined to when the scrolling stops, the focus representing that the object is being selected.

  • Publication number: 20170034568
    Abstract: A video/audio processing apparatus includes a video generator, a selector, and a volume controller. The video generator generates a video signal for display video in which a plurality of regions, in each of which a moving image is displayed, automatically move in a display screen in a predetermined direction. The selector selects an audio signal of one moving image, of a plurality of the moving images, in accordance with positions of a plurality of the moving images in the display screen. The volume controller controls volumes of audio signals of a plurality of the moving images so that a volume of the audio signal selected by the selector is higher than volumes of other audio signals.

  • Patent number: 8588588
    Abstract: Using a remote control, a viewer specifies the channel and the date and time of a program that he/she wants to watch. A reception method selection unit determines, based on the date and time, whether the program is currently being broadcast or was broadcast in the past, and then selects a reception method. An SI information storage unit stores URL information of program distribution servers having past programs. The URL information is contained in the SDT in SI information transmitted together with a program. When the viewer chooses a past program, an IP data reception unit connects to the corresponding program distribution server based on its URL so as to transmit the date and time thereto, and receives the past program that the viewer wants to watch via IP network.

  • Publication number: 20090282434
    Abstract: There is provided a digital broadcast receiver for solving various problems regarding a display which arise due to the switching of a mode. For example, there is provided a digital broadcast receiver capable of displaying an emergency alert broadcast by an EAS even when a mode is switched from an OCAP mode to an external input mode. The receiver has a plane management unit for managing a receiver only plane and a download application plane. The receiver prohibits the emergency alert broadcast from being displayed in the receiver only plane when, under an OCAP mode, a download application takes away an EAS function of the receiver, and then permits the emergency alert broadcast to be displayed in the receiver only plane when the mode is switched from the OCAP mode to an external input mode.

  • Publication number: 20090055881
    Abstract: There is provided a cable broadcast receiver for solving problems arising in the switching between execution of a download application and reproduction of video audio information from an external device. The receiver has operating modes including a first mode and a second mode. Under the first mode, the receiver is operated based on a download application acquired through a network. Under the second mode, the receiver is operated based on a receiver application. The receiver is operated under the second mode when information inputted from an external device is to be displayed. A key delivery unit delivers, upon receiving a key code instructing a channel change during the operation under the second mode, the key code indicating the channel change to a download application management unit which controls the key delivery to the download application, and a receiver application management unit which controls the key delivery to the receiver application.

  • Publication number: 20090055870
    Abstract: A digital broadcast receiving apparatus that utilizes an unused tuner effectively to shorten channel selection time is disclosed. The apparatus is equipped with plural tuners that receive digital broadcast waves; a TS processing unit capable of processing at least two TSes demodulated by the tuner; a service information acquiring unit that extracts service information from the TS processing unit; a data contents acquiring unit that caches data contents; an audio and visual output control unit capable of processing plural audio and visual data simultaneously or alternately by switching; and a channel selection control unit that predicts a channel that the user is likely to select next time and preliminarily performs predicted channel selection process using a tuner currently not selected.
